Technical and Economic Analysis of Promoting the Application of ACCC in China

Article Preview

Abstract:

This paper presents that Aluminium Conductor Composite Core (abbreviated as ACCC) is suitable for using in reconstructed overhead line projects, but is not economical for using in new construction projects in China. When ACCC can be used in new overhead line projects, the cut-off point price is twice of the conventional Aluminium Conductor Steel Reinforced (abbreviated as ACSR) under same section,and further analysis of price components of ACCC is considered that the prices could decrease further. In China, ACCC will have application value for large area popularization.
